The dissertation “Lírica Líquida: a água na poesia de Cecília Meireles e de Sophia Andresen” (Liquid Lyric: the water in a Cecilia Meireles and Sophia Andresen’s poetry) is the research's final result which main objective was to analyze some poems of the books Mar absoluto e outros poemas, by Cecília Meireles, and Poesia, by Sophia Andresen, for establishing the subjectivity expression composed by the water symbols. As a comparative study, the objective execution was done through specifics objectives which were: list some moments in a XX century, that are able to situate the chosen books; establish a discussion around the creational poetic process used by Cecília Meireles and Sophia Andresen; explain subjectivity and otherness, justifying their presence in the chosen poems; and, finally, establish a comparison or by similarity or by dissimilarity between the poems whose themes and images appear linked to the water element. As a literary analysis, this research was developed through bibliographic methodology, by theoretical and critics texts systematization, as well as selection of poems contained in the chosen books. In this way, this introduction text’s brings some general elements about poetry, the new humanism's theory, by Emmanuel Lévinas, the material imagination theory, by Gaston Bachelard and the thematic criticism theory, considered by Daniel Bergez. The first chapter is composed by contextual elements about the twentieth century that surrounded these author’s poetic production; then, it is listed the literary criticism about Cecília Meireles and Sophia Andresen. The second chapter, by its turn, is constituted by the analysis of the chosen poems in the mentioned books. The third chapter, so, establishes the comparison for similarity or dissimilarity of themes that each one of writers had treated. This dissertation is concluded making a synthesis of the presented discussion in each chapter and proposing that the relation between Cecília Meireles’ and Sophia Andresen’s poetry provides elements for a comparative study based in the influence that cecilian’s poetry has over the andresenian’s poetry and that the subjectivity expression related to the water image, like a mirror, evokes some questions about ethic and static esthetic.
